Deciduous Azalea Jock Brydon
- Code: AJOCK
- Flower Colour: Pink
- Flowering Month: May-June
- Height After 10 Years: 150-175cm
- Interesting Foliage: No
- Scent: Scented
- Hardiness: To -20 °C
Striking pinky white flowers with a bold speckled reddish orange blotch and wavy ruffled edges. A stunning occidentale hybrid with a good scent in May and June. This is vigorous as a young plant with arching branches. Height 150-180cm in 10 years.
- Recommended for striking scented flowers.
- Easy to grow.
- Group:Deciduous Azalea (Occidentale hybrid).
- Parentage: molle subsp. molle X occidentale.
- Hybridization date: pre 2000 (1968).
- Bred by: Clausen. Origin: American.
- Habit: upright.
- Ideal position: Most garden situations.
- Ideal soil: pH 4.5 to 6.
- RHS Hardiness Rating: H4.
- How we usually propagate this plant: Cutting.
